Read MoreThe Cartier Tank watch is a timeless icon in horology, celebrated for its minimalist elegance and enduring legacy. Introduced in 1917 by Louis Cartier, its design was inspired by the Renault tanks used during World War I, blending geometric symmetry with Art Deco refinement. The rectangular case, clean lines, and Roman numeral dial make it instantly recognizable, a favorite among connoisseurs and collectors.
Crafted with precision, the Cartier Tank features a sapphire crystal, blued steel hands, and various movements, from manual to automatic. Its versatility shines through collections like the Tank Solo, Tank Française, and Tank Américaine, each catering to distinct tastes while retaining its classic DNA. Worn by luminaries like Jackie Kennedy and Andy Warhol, the Cartier Tank transcends trends, representing sophistication and heritage. A true masterpiece, it stands as a testament to Cartier’s unparalleled craftsmanship and innovative spirit in luxury watchmaking.

The Louis Cartier Tank is a hallmark of refined elegance, showcasing a rectangular design inspired by WWI military tanks. It emphasizes minimalist sophistication and timeless appeal, making it perfect for formal settings. Compared to other Cartier models like the Santos de Cartier or Ballon Bleu, the Tank stands out for its historical significance and understated design. The Santos, known for its aviation roots and square case, has a sportier vibe, while the Ballon Bleu offers a modern, rounded aesthetic with a playful crown detail. Each model caters to different tastes but shares Cartier’s commitment to luxury and craftsmanship.

The Tank Louis Cartier, introduced in 1922, is the quintessential model of the Tank collection. This watch embodies the purest essence of Cartier’s design philosophy, blending timeless sophistication with understated luxury. Its rectangular case, clean lines, and slim profile make it a symbol of refinement, perfect for formal occasions or everyday elegance. A favorite among style icons and collectors, the Tank Louis Cartier remains a benchmark for classic watch design.

The Tank Française introduced in 1996, brings a contemporary twist to the iconic Tank design. With its integrated metal bracelet and slightly curved rectangular case, it combines elegance with a sporty and modern feel. This model is perfect for those seeking a timepiece that seamlessly transitions from casual to formal wear. The Tank Française maintains Cartier’s signature elements, such as Roman numerals and the sapphire crown, while offering a fresh, robust design.

The Tank Américaine, introduced in 1989, is a striking reinterpretation of the classic Tank design. With its elongated rectangular case and curved profile, it combines boldness with elegance. Inspired by the Tank Cintrée, it modernizes the aesthetic with a more substantial presence on the wrist. This model is perfect for those seeking a statement piece that retains Cartier’s timeless sophistication.

The Tank Cintrée, introduced in 1921, is one of the most refined and elegant interpretations of the Tank collection. Its name, meaning “curved” in French, reflects its slim, elongated case with a pronounced curve that hugs the wrist. Celebrated for its vintage appeal and timeless sophistication, the Tank Cintrée is a favorite among collectors and those who appreciate understated luxury.

The Tank Must, inspired by the 1970s Must de Cartier collection, is a contemporary take on the timeless Tank design. Known for its affordability and vibrant appeal, the Tank Must combines classic elements with modern innovations, such as eco-friendly solar-powered movements. It retains the signature rectangular case, Roman numerals, and blue sword-shaped hands, while introducing fresh options for new-generation watch enthusiasts.

Taking care of your Louis Cartier Tank watch, as a valuable investment, requires great attention and care. First of all, avoiding direct contact of the watch with water, chemicals and detergents is of great importance. Also, strong blows and sudden changes in temperature can severely damage the sensitive components of the watch’s internal mechanism, and you should pay special attention to this issue. Periodic cleaning of your Louis Cartier Tank watch with a microfiber cloth helps maintain the shine of the body.
Since Cartier Tank watches are often made of high-quality and delicate materials, be sure to refer to specialized Cartier centers for any repairs or services. By following these simple tips, you can ensure the long life and lasting beauty of your Louis Cartier Tank watch.

The price range for a Cartier Tank is very wide and depends on several factors, including the material used (yellow gold, white gold, rose gold or steel), the type of strap (leather, steel or gold), the size of the watch, the year of manufacture, the overall condition of the watch, as well as the pre-owned watch market.
The unique design of the Cartier Tank, combined with the unsurpassed build quality and the brand’s global reputation, make it a lasting investment that will retain its value over time. However, the value of a Louis Cartier Tank is not precisely predictable and may vary in different markets and at different times.
